Understanding WHY HOA Décor Rules Exist
HOAs set decoration rules to keep the neighborhood looking consistent. They want to protect property values and avoid safety hazards. That is a fair goal, but it can feel frustrating when you just want to enjoy the holidays.
Most HOA guidelines cover things like how early you can put up decorations, when they must come down, which colors or styles are allowed, and where lights can be placed on your home. Violating these rules can result in fines or written warnings. Problem 1: You Do Not Know What Your HOA Allows
This is one of the most common HOA décor pain points. Many homeowners do not read their CC&Rs closely, or the rules are written in confusing legal language. Before you buy a single strand of lights, pull out your HOA documents and look for the holiday decoration section.
If you cannot find clear answers, contact your HOA board directly. Ask for a written list of what is and is not allowed. Once you have that information, a professional installer can use it to design a display that fits the rules exactly.
Problem 2: Damage to Your Home or Landscaping
One big reason HOAs restrict decorations is that homeowners sometimes cause damage during DIY installs. Nails, staples, and improper clips can crack roof tiles, damage gutters, or harm siding. That kind of damage can cost hundreds or even thousands of dollars to repair.
Professional installers use clips and hardware that are designed to hold lights securely without causing damage. They also know which surfaces need special care. Problem 3: Lights Left Up Too Long
Many HOAs require holiday decorations to come down by a specific date, often January 15th or February 1st. Leaving lights up past that deadline is one of the fastest ways to get a violation notice.
